Package: shorewall
Version: 4.5.5.3-1
Severity: normal
Dear Maintainer,
Shorewall logging causes incorrect prefix to show in syslog:
Jul 11 09:09:34 webhost kernel: [89535.830300] --log-prefixIN=eth0 OUT=
MAC=00:0c:29:f7:0c:4b:00:1a:64:20:3c:12:08:00 SRC=199.253.60.146 etc.
as oppose to correct
